A silicon (Si) atom has 14 protons and typically 14 neutrons. Protons are located in the nucleus at the center of the atom, while neutrons are also found in the nucleus alongside the protons. The number of neutrons can vary slightly due to the presence of isotopes, but the most common isotope of silicon has 14 neutrons.

A neutral atom of Silicon-27 contains 14 protons, just like any atom of Silicon (Si). Silicon has an atomic number of 14. The most abundant form of Si is Silicon-28, which has 14 neutrons. Silicon-27 has 13 neutrons.
The number of neutrons is different for each isotope: 14, 15, 16 neutrons for the natural stable isotopes of silicon.

Silicon-29 has 14 protons (atomic number), 14 electrons if the atom is neutral, and 15 neutrons (mass number - atomic number).
Si-28: 14 protons and electrons, 14 neutronsNi-60: 28 protons and electrons, 32 neutronsRb-85: 37 protons and electrons, 48 neutronsXe-128: 54 protons and electrons, 74 neutronsPt-195: 78 protons and electrons, 117 neutronsU-238: 92 protons and electrons, 146 neutrons
The mass number of an isotope is the sum of its protons and neutrons. Since silicon has 14 protons, the isotope with 15 neutrons would have a mass number of 14 (protons) + 15 (neutrons) = 29.

A silicon-28 atom has 14 protons, 14 neutrons, and 14 electrons. The number of protons determines the element (silicon in this case), the sum of protons and neutrons gives the atomic mass of the isotope (28 in this case), and the number of electrons balances the charge to make the atom electrically neutral.
